IROC is a 54,000 square foot facility housing a four lane swimming pool, 94 foot waterslide, and therapy pool, a fitness center, a multipurpose sports center and free 1/10th of a mile, padded, Rotary Walking Track, a community room, board room, and technology center.  It is located in Derby, VT, serving Orleans County, Northern Essex County Vermont and Stanstead, Quebec.  It has over 5,000 regular users and serves as a venue for a wide variety of events and activities.  

In warm weather, it hosts the Dandelion Run, a relay marathon in May, the Tour de Kingdom, a two day century ride in June, the Kingdom Swim a 10, 3 and 1 mile open water swim in July, the Kingdom Triathlon a 500 yard swim, a 13 mile bike and a 5 mile run in August and the Woodsman Competition in September featuring log splitting, pulp tossing, and log rolling.

In November of 2006, IROC started the goundbreaking and highly successful, Healthy Changes Initiative, for people suffering from chronic conditions such as Diabetes, Obesity, and Heart Disease to attract them and retain them in a long term program of regular exercise.  During the second year of the program, 54% of thpse enrolled at the beginning of the year remained actively enrolled 12 months later.
